Aleksander Larsen, the co-founder of Sky Mavis, pointed out that play-to-earn does not work in its current state.

When asked about the relevance of P2E in 2023, the Sky Mavis executive admitted that the model is currently flawed. He explained that:

Zoe Wei, the senior business director at BNB Chain, echoed Larsen’s thoughts. According to the executive, further experimentation and analysis are necessary to make the token economies of most games sustainable. Apart from the NFT gaming models, Wei also commented on the topic of traditional game producers coming into the space. Wei believes that blockchain technology and NFTs have"undeniable benefits" for game producers and gamers. “We have already seen countless gaming studios venture into web3 over the past year, and this is a trend that will continue into 2023,” Wei added.

Pereira also mentioned that while Asian gaming firms are more public in their crypto push, western firms are also swooping in, but are"being more cautious with their PR." Nevertheless, the executive believes that the trend will continue.
